Commercial Metals Balance Sheet Health
Financial Health criteria checks 6/6
Commercial Metals has a total shareholder equity of $4.2B and total debt of $1.1B, which brings its debt-to-equity ratio to 24.8%. Its total assets and total liabilities are $6.7B and $2.5B respectively. Commercial Metals's EBIT is $1.1B making its interest coverage ratio 27.1. It has cash and short-term investments of $704.6M.

Financial Position Analysis
Short Term Liabilities: CMS's short term assets ($3.2B) exceed its short term liabilities ($787.0M).
Long Term Liabilities: CMS's short term assets ($3.2B) exceed its long term liabilities ($1.7B).
Debt to Equity History and Analysis
Debt Level: CMS's net debt to equity ratio (8.2%) is considered satisfactory.
Reducing Debt: CMS's debt to equity ratio has reduced from 89.8% to 24.8% over the past 5 years.
Debt Coverage: CMS's debt is well covered by operating cash flow (117.3%).
Interest Coverage: CMS's interest payments on its debt are well covered by EBIT (27.1x coverage).
